What is the difference between proofreading and copywriting?

Proofreaders don’t suggest major changes to the text; rather, they look for minor text and formatting errors and confirm the material is ready for publication. Copy editing and proofreading are separate tasks, although the terms are sometimes used interchangeably by people who don’t know the difference.

How do I get certified in copyediting?

Copy Editor Certification In most cases, those steps mean taking specific courses either through a college or through professional organizations. New York University awards the certificate to those who complete three required courses and two electives over a period of three years.

Tips For Effective Proofreading

  1. Proofread backwards.
  2. Place a ruler under each line as you read it.
  3. Know your own typical mistakes.
  4. Proofread for one type of error at a time.
  5. Try to make a break between writing and proofreading.
  6. Proofread at the time of day when you are most alert to spotting errors.
  7. Proofread once aloud.

How much do proofreaders charge UK?

Fees for proofreading and copy-editing can be calculated as an hourly or daily rate, per 1,000 words or for a whole project. Because clients’ needs vary hugely, so do my rates, which can range from £13 to £35 per 1000 words. As a rough guideline, my day rate is between £260 and £400.

How do I get proofreading certificate?

For U.S. proofreaders, one option is to take the Certificate in Editing and Proofreading course through ACS Distance Education. After the 600-hour course, you’ll take an exam and receive a certificate.
